Device shutdown via unsolicited LMP response flooding
Published Nov 30, 2021 · Updated Aug 3, 2024
Denial of service in Actions ATS2815 Bluetooth Classic firmware allows physically proximate attackers to shut down devices via LMP response floods. The Bluetooth Classic link manager processes continuous unsolicited LMP_features_res packets at 1.25 ms intervals without limiting the responses, causing firmware shutdown. Attackers must know the target Bluetooth address and remain in radio range; affected devices require manual power-on to restore service.
